The following General Terms and Conditions (hereinafter "Terms") regulate the contractual relationship between Benny Dance (hereinafter "the Studio") and the member, in accordance with the Civil Code (BGB). The philosophy of Benny Dance prioritizes transparency, fairness and customer satisfaction.

1. Membership models and prices

Benny Dance offers the following membership models, designed for different commitment and flexibility needs:

Rate (Plan) Monthly price Minimum duration
Flexible Rate 49,99 EUR None (cancelable monthly)
Annual Rate 39,99 EUR 12 months
2-Year Rate 29,99 EUR 24 months

2. Service promise and class schedule

Service guarantee: Unlike other dance schools, Benny Dance commits to maintaining regular class operation or an alternative program during the 52 weeks of the year, including legal holidays, to guarantee maximum availability.

Instructor absence: In case of an instructor absence, the Studio guarantees service provision through a substitute, an online offer or a make-up class.

3. Cancellation rights and early termination

Our cancellation conditions seek a fair balance between the contractual commitment and the unforeseen circumstances of our members:

Special cancellation for justified cause: We understand that unforeseen and serious situations may arise (such as a prolonged injury or illness, pregnancy or a move to a city outside our coverage area). In these cases, the contract can be cancelled early by submitting the corresponding official or medical proof, without retroactive adjustments to the flexible rate price. This cancellation takes effect with one (1) calendar month notice. This means the contract ends at the end of the month following the cancellation and the member is exempt from additional payments for the rest of the contractual period.

Ordinary cancellation / without justified cause: If the member cancels early without a legally recognized serious reason (according to BGB), the member remains obliged to pay the agreed fees until the end of the contractual period.

4. Fees and administrative costs

Benny Dance charges administrative fees strictly based on real costs, to avoid disproportionate surcharges:

  • Activation fee: A one-time activation fee is paid upon first registration.
  • Card loss or reactivation: A fee of 5.00 EUR is charged for replacing the physical member card or reactivating the access code.
  • Direct debit return costs: In case of a direct debit return attributable to the member (e.g. insufficient funds), a processing fee of 5.00 EUR is charged to cover actual bank costs.
  • Reminder fees: A flat fee of 1.00 EUR is charged for each payment reminder/formal notification sent (from the moment of non-payment).

5. Right of withdrawal and value compensation

Legal 14-day withdrawal period: In distance contracts (online), the member has the right to withdraw from the contract within 14 days.

Early start and value compensation: If the member expressly requests (e.g. by checking a box in the registration process) that the service begins before the 14-day withdrawal period and subsequently exercises the right of withdrawal, the member is legally obliged to pay a value compensation for the services provided up to the withdrawal. This compensation is calculated strictly in proportion to the value of the classes used (example: if the rate includes 4 classes and 2 were attended before the withdrawal, 50 % of the monthly fee is paid).

6. Special introductory promotion

"First month free": This promotion is exclusive to members who sign up for the annual rate (39.99 EUR). To ensure the validity of the contract, the member pays the first month fee (39.99 EUR). This amount is fully offset or refunded with the payment of the second month.

Legal condition: By taking advantage of this promotion for the annual rate, the member acknowledges that if the right of withdrawal is exercised within 14 days, the value compensation rule (see point 5) applies fully to the classes already taken.

7. Intellectual property and recordings

Choreographies: The reproduction, distribution or commercial use of the choreographies and concepts taught in the classes without prior written consent of the Studio is expressly prohibited.

Recordings by the Studio: The Studio is authorized to make photographic and video recordings of the classes for promotional purposes. The member retains at all times the right to object to the recording of their person (opt-out).

Recordings by members: To protect the privacy of all members and avoid legal claims, it is strictly prohibited for members to make their own recordings (videos or photos) during classes.

8. Absence and force majeure

Member absence: Non-participation in classes for personal reasons (vacation, work reasons, mild illness, etc.) does not exempt from the payment obligation and gives no right to a refund.

Force majeure: If the Studio must temporarily suspend operations due to force majeure (e.g. official orders related to a pandemic), the contract is paused at no cost. The duration of this pause is added in full to the end of the regular contractual period.
